Phakic iris-claw intraocular lens: calculations of power and long-term endothelial cells loss

Research output: Articles / NotesLetterpeer-review

Abstract

A correction about phakic intraocular lens power calculation process, as it was stated by Li, Song & Song, is provided. It is explained that this calculation is based on the Van der Heijde formula and not on biometric formulas. A comment about the mechanisms of late endothelial cell loss following phakic intraocular lenses is done.
